So I brought my car in for Alberto to take a look at it yesterday and hopefully take care of the CEL that I had. My wife had to take the car to Alberto so I didn't get to meet him unfortunately but he kept me in the loop, called me every step of the way to let me know what was going on, what he was doing, as well as what he suggested that I should get fixed soon. My wife said that he was very kind and really knew his stuff. Also the waiting area had Netflix, lots of DVDs, and a game console which is great because my wife wasn't looking forward to bringing the car in but she was perfectly fine waiting there in the waiting room. I was told at Autozone that my O2 sensors were bad but after Alberto took a look at it he found that there were quite a few boost leaks and once that was established he had the car fixed in about an hour and 15 minutes.

 

I got in the car when I got home from work and the shuddering that had been going on for a few weeks was completely taken care of. The car seems to perform better (although that could just be in my head). I am very happy with the work done by Alberto and I will be going back to him again soon to get my 100k maintenance done as well as the axle boot which he told me needed to be repaired and gave me prices for a new one (both aftermarket and OEM prices so I could choose which I wanted).

 

All in all I am extremely happy with the service at Motive Auto Works and I will be going there for any future service that I need taken care of and I would recommend him to anybody that needs to have work done on their car.
